▎ 摘  要

NOVELTY - A graphene electromagnetic shielding cloth has an anti-piercing layer, a base cloth layer, a copper oxide layer, a copper layer, adhesive film layer (I), graphene composite fabric layer (I), a material cloth layer, adhesive film layer (II) and graphene composite fabric layer (II). The base cloth layer is made of blended fabric. The adhesive film layer (I) and adhesive film layer (II) comprise graphene powder. The resistance value of the graphene composite fabric layer (I) is greater than the resistance value of the graphene composite fabric layer (II). The resistance value of adhesive film layer (I) is greater than resistance value of adhesive film layer (II). The copper layer is subjected to surface blasting, and has surface roughness of greater than 0.05. USE - Graphene electromagnetic shielding cloth. ADVANTAGE - The graphene electromagnetic shielding cloth has improved shielding effect, durability and mechanical property. DETAILED DESCRIPTION - An INDEPENDENT CLAIM is included for manufacture of graphene electromagnetic shielding cloth.
